Description
Part of a series of traditional Japanese/Chinese villas, each with a main house and a small pagoda. Each comes UNfurnished, decorated and landscaped. Horyu-Ji is built in a rich, ornate style, and works in every version of the game. No custom objects included, no hacks – ready to furnish.
Creator Notes
If you leave Shadows On in this lot, some of the Japanese roofs will have a slight horizontal line. For best effect, turn Shadows OFF in this lot. If playing Seasons, the attic floors will get a light dusting of snow or a puddle - doesn't affect Sims at all! :).
